NOXIOUS WEEDS (EXCERPT)
Act 359 of 1941


247.68 Department of agriculture; duty to enforce law; cooperation with commissioners.

Sec. 8.

The department of agriculture is authorized and it shall be its duty to assist in the enforcement of this law. The department shall cooperate with the various commissioners of noxious weeds in carrying out the provisions of this act and shall advise them from time to time of the most effective methods of treating and eradicating noxious weeds.


History: 1941, Act 359, Eff. Jan. 10, 1942 ;-- CL 1948, 247.68
